Responsibilities
- Lead the statistical design and execution of individual oncology protocols, including sample size calculations, randomization schemes, and adaptive design simulations.
- Implement and execute trial-level dose-finding methodologies, such as Bayesian Optimal Interval (BOIN), and cohort expansion models.
- Program, validate, and perform statistical analyses for trial data cuts, Safety Review Committees, and Dose Escalation Meetings.
- Author trial-specific Statistical Analysis Plans, design shell tables, listings, and figures (TLFs), and write statistical sections of Clinical Study Reports (CSRs).
- Design and build dynamic data visualizations, dashboards, and interactive graphics (e.g., using R/Shiny) to track real-time dose escalation, safety signals, and biomarker trends.
- Translate complex statistical outputs and trial models into intuitive, high-impact visual decks for executive leadership, investors, and scientific advisory boards.
- Provide direct technical oversight to CRO programmers and biostatisticians, verifying all trial-level deliverables for quality and accuracy.
- Prepare data packages and statistical rationales for Investigational New Drug (IND) submissions and expedited regulatory filings.
- Serve as the core biostatistician on clinical trial working groups, collaborating daily with Clinical Leads, Data Managers, and Biomarker scientists.
- Blend pharmacokinetic (PK/PD) and translational biomarker data into trial-level exploratory analyses to identify early safety or efficacy signals.
